LSEQ Description

Under normal market circumstances, the fund invests at least 80% of its net assets, plus borrowings for investment purposes, in long and short positions in equity securities. The fund advisor seeks to achieve the fund's investment objective by establishing long and/or short positions in equity securities.

QMID Description Under normal circumstances, the fund invests at least 80% of its net assets in the constituent securities of its index, each of which is a security issued by a mid-cap company, identified in accordance with the index provider"s market-capitalization selection parameters, that is incorporated and headquartered in the United States.
